Investing in Diamond Jewellery: What You Need to Know

Considering acquiring diamond jewelry as a way to wealth? It’s a intricate proposition. While diamonds might hold value, they aren't invariably a sound investment like gold. The market for diamond adornments is significantly influenced by changes in availability, consumer desire , and economic conditions. Unlike other valuables, diamonds lack a consistent resale value . Factors such as design, clarity , carat , and shade greatly impact a diamond’s price , so thorough research and professional advice are essential before you commit your resources .

The Ultimate Guide to Diamond Jewellery Care

To keep your precious diamond jewellery looking their very best, regular care is vital . Regularly clean your diamonds with a gentle cloth after each time to get rid of lotions . For a more deep cleaning , use a mild soap and warm liquid , ensuring you wash them thoroughly and dry them with a lint-free cloth. Steer clear of harsh solutions and ultrasonic devices , as these can potentially damage the setting . Lastly , expert servicing is suggested at least once year.

Diamond Jewellery: Styles & Settings Explained

Understanding diamond jewellery can feel daunting , but knowing the fundamental styles and settings unlocks a world of beauty . Common styles include solitaire pieces, which feature a single diamond, often set in a simple band. Halo settings frame a central diamond with tiny accent stones, maximizing perceived size and brilliance . Then there’s the pave setting website – pave boasts a coating of tiny diamonds, while prong settings securely fasten the diamond with thin metal claws. Retro styles frequently incorporate detailed settings like bezel (where a metal rim fully encloses the diamond) or channel (where diamonds are set between metal rails ). Ultimately, the ideal setting depends on your unique taste and the desired look.
